[16] In 1968, when he was 12 years old, he encountered Charles Manson while riding horses with his cousin at the Spahn Ranch. Bryan Lee Cranston was born in Hollywood, Los Angeles[3][4] and the second of three children born to Annalisa "Peggy" (ne Sell; 19232004), a radio actress, and Joseph Louis Cranston (19242014), an actor and former amateur boxer. Cranston took on the role of Howard Beale from opening night through 2019 to great acclaim, including his second Tony win. His maternal grandparents were German immigrants, while his father was of Austrian-Jewish, Irish, and German descent. [69] On July 8, 1989,[70] he married Robin Dearden[71] whom he had met on the set of the series Airwolf in 1984; he was playing the villain of the week and she played a hostage he held at gunpoint. [79][80], Cranston and castmate Aaron Paul both got Breaking Bad tattoos on the last day of filming to commemorate the final episode of Breaking Bad; Cranston's tattoo consists of the show's logo on his right ring finger, while Paul's tattoo consists of "no half measures" on his biceps.
